Writing a good essay for AP Lit is like crafting a story about a book. Start by reading carefully and understanding the text, just like unraveling a mystery.

While there's no strict outline for AP Lit essays, you can follow a general structure to organize your thoughts effectively:

1. Introduction:

- Start with a hook or interesting fact related to the text.

- Introduce the book and author.

- Present your thesis statement, expressing your main argument.

2. Body Paragraphs (usually 3 or more):

- Begin each paragraph with a clear topic sentence.

- Provide evidence from the text to support your points.

- Analyze the quotes and explain how they relate to your thesis.

- Connect back to the overall theme or purpose.

3. Conclusion:

- Summarize your main points.

- Reinforce the significance of your argument.

- End with a thought-provoking statement or a connection to the broader context.

Remember, adapt this outline based on the specific prompt and requirements of your essay. Remember that getting good grades in your essay, it is not enough to read about the techniques, you have practice as often as you can without the aid of autocorrection tools.
